Grant Overview

Data-Driven Strategies for Student Success

In an era increasingly defined by technological advancements, data-driven strategies have become integral to enhancing educational outcomes, particularly for at-risk and underserved students. This funding initiative specifically addresses the implementation of comprehensive data systems in educational institutions to effectively monitor and evaluate student progress. It covers areas such as real-time data analysis, predictive modeling for student performance, and personalized education interventions. Excluded from this funding scope are initiatives that do not prioritize technology integration or that focus solely on traditional pedagogical methods without leveraging data insights.

Real-World Applications and Use Cases

Real-world scenarios illustrate the effectiveness of data-driven approaches. For instance, consider a school district that deploys a data monitoring system to track student attendance and performance metrics. By analyzing patterns in attendance alongside academic achievement scores, educators can identify students who may be struggling shortly after disengagement begins, allowing them to implement tailored support before the problem escalates. Another example is a school utilizing real-time analytics to adjust lesson pacing based on student understanding captured during assessments, ensuring that instruction is continuously aligned with student needs and promoting overall academic success.

Who Should Apply for This Funding

This funding opportunity is ideally suited for K-12 schools and districts that are committed to advancing their educational practices through technology. Institutions that have demonstrated readiness through existing digital infrastructure or have prior experience in implementing educational technology initiatives may find themselves in a favorable position to secure funding. On the contrary, schools that lack the foundational support for technology integration, or that do not have a clear implementation plan, may struggle to meet eligibility criteria.

Factors That Determine Alignment with Fund Objectives

To successfully align with this funding, schools must demonstrate a clear intent to utilize technology as a lever for change. This includes having a strategic plan that connects their data initiatives to specific educational outcomes, such as improving graduation rates or reducing achievement gaps. Additionally, schools are encouraged to showcase past successes in data utilization or preliminary steps taken to create an integrated data system, which can strengthen their application. The funders are particularly focused on innovative projects with the potential for scalability and systemic improvement in learning environments.
